Excelerate Energy Inc. reported Q1 2026 earnings per share of $0.37, falling short of the consensus estimate of $0.3904 by 5.23%. Revenue figures were not disclosed in the release. Despite the modest earnings miss, the company’s stock rose 2.13% in the session, reflecting investor confidence in the company’s operational stability and long-term LNG market positioning.

Excelerate Energy’s Q1 performance was marked by steady utilization of its floating storage and regasification units (FSRUs), which remain the core of its business model. While the EPS miss indicates slightly higher-than-expected operating costs or lower throughput margins, the company continued to benefit from long-term terminal service agreements that provide recurring revenue stability. Operational highlights include the successful completion of planned maintenance at its LNG import terminals and progress on regasification capacity expansions in key markets such as South Asia and the Middle East. Margins may have been pressured by temporary volume fluctuations and higher natural gas procurement costs during the quarter. However, Excelerate’s focus on cost discipline and contract indexation helps protect profitability over the medium term. The company’s diversified portfolio of regasification assets and its ability to offer flexible LNG solutions continue to differentiate it in the competitive energy infrastructure space. Excelerate Energy did not provide specific guidance for the remainder of fiscal 2026, but management reiterated its strategic priorities: expanding FSRU capacity, deepening relationships with emerging market utilities, and exploring growth opportunities in carbon-neutral LNG services. The company anticipates that global LNG demand growth, particularly in Asia and Europe, may support higher utilization rates in the coming quarters. Key risk factors include potential volatility in global gas prices, geopolitical disruptions affecting supply chains, and the pace of regulatory approvals for new infrastructure projects. Additionally, competition from other regasification providers and the gradual shift toward renewable energy could influence long-term contract dynamics. Excelerate expects to maintain a disciplined capital allocation approach, prioritizing debt reduction and shareholder returns while investing in selective growth projects. Despite the EPS miss, Excelerate Energy’s shares rose 2.13%, suggesting that the market may have already priced in a weaker result or that investors are focusing on the company’s stable cash flow prospects. Analyst reactions have been cautiously positive, with some noting that the miss was narrow and that the underlying business fundamentals remain intact. The stock’s resilience points to confidence in the company’s contracted revenue base and its ability to navigate short-term headwinds. Looking ahead, investors will watch for updates on FSRU utilization rates, new contract wins, and any guidance on second-half margins. The broader natural gas market trends and regulatory developments in key operating regions will also be critical. Given the company’s low leverage and strong operational track record, Excelerate may offer a defensive profile within the energy infrastructure space, though valuation multiples should be weighed against the lack of near-term revenue catalysts.
